Sorana Cîrstea scored a clear victory over Argentina's Maria Lourdes Carle, 6-1, 6-4 in an 85-minute match. After the match, Cîrstea talked about her emotions about the retirement of her generation, saying that she doesn't know if Romania will have such a talented generation with multiple players in the Top 100. Although aware that she is nearing the end of her career, she continues to play for the love of the sport.
